#B91BAE Hex Color Code

#B91BAE

The Hexadecimal Color #B91BAE is a contrast shade of Medium Violet Red. #B91BAE RGB value is rgb(185, 27, 174). RGB Color Model of #B91BAE consists of 72% red, 10% green and 68% blue. HSL color Mode of #B91BAE has 304°(degrees) Hue, 75% Saturation and 42% Lightness. #B91BAE color has an wavelength of 428.59259n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#B91BAE is #CC33C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#B91BAE is #B2A. The Closest Color to #B91BAE is #C71585. Official Name of #B91BAE Hex Code is Violet Eggplant.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#B91BAE is 0 Cyan 85 Magenta 6 Yellow 27 Black and #B91BAE CMY is 0, 85, 6.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#B91BAE

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
